Checking Air Bag and Belt Tensioner System:









































Test Instructions for Tester 126 589 10 21 00 (revised)
Before testing with the tester, the airbag restraint system must be tested by means of the RS/SRS warning lamp (A1e15). With the ignition switched on, the RS/SRS warning lamp should light up for approx. 10 s, or approx. 4 s in vehicles with airbag 1/3. If necessary, check warning lamp or cable.

WARNING: Each time before disconnecting the red test coupling/plug connection for airbag, 10-pin (X29/9), to connect the tester, the ignition key must be turned to position "0", the negative terminal of the battery disconnected and covered. Then reconnect the battery for the test.
